NTFS是一个重大的里程碑,相对以前的FAT和FAT32磁盘格式有很大的进步,然而最重要的则是它的权限设置,它的设置可以帮助我们更好的管理文件,可是我们可以发现似乎U盘并没有格式化成NTFS的选项,真的是这样吗?
其实不然,U盘其实也可以格式化成NTFS格式。这里可提供两种方法:

 
一、将U盘插上后,在“设备管理器”中,选择“磁盘驱动器”下的你的那个U盘,在其“属性”对话框中的“策略”页中,选中“为提高性能而优化”,单击确定。然后我们右击U盘,选择“格式化”,从“文件系统”中选择NTFS格式,然后格式化U盘即可。(默认情况下,“文件系统”中是没有NTFS格式可供选择的,只有选择“为提高性能优化”后才有,可以对比一下选择“为提高性能优化”前后“文件类型”的种类就知道了。下面有图)
 
 
选择“为提高性能而优化”选项后,如图:
 
而没有选择其选项之前,如图:
 
 
二、Windows自带的命令中有Convert命令,它也可以达到同样的效果,打开“命令提示符”,输入:“Convert X:/fs:ntfs”(不包含引号,X是U盘的盘符,例如我的就是H),回车后等一会儿就OK了。
 
NTFS还有很多优点,例如NTFS的U盘在传输文件时可谓比以前快了1.5-2倍;我们可以通过压缩,让一个1G的U盘当成1.3G的来用;还可以通过权限有效的防止AUTORUN.inf病毒的威胁……这里限于个人的水平就不滥竽充数了,如果大家感兴趣可以在网上找到相关的文章进行阅读。
 
其实,NTFS文件系统并适合闪存,作为日志型文件系统,对文件的每一次操作都会作详细记录,同一个操作,可能在FAT(泛指FAT12/16/32,下同)下就只是读/写一次,但在NTFS下就很可能是若干次读/写,这点对于像U盘这类对读写次数敏感的闪存设备是极为不利的,会严重缩短使用寿命。所以,相比FAT,过于复杂的NTFS并不适合于U盘。
 
MS在NT6(VISTA+SP1/SERVER 2008)代的操作系统中全新加入一种专门为闪存设计的exFAT文件系统。exFAT是个折中的格式,不仅降低U盘的读写,增加大文件的支持,也提高了不少小文件的读写速度。但是默认的XP是不支持这种格式的,但是Windows XP 更新程序 (KB955704)解决了这一问题,
 
从上面的截图中,大家应该知道,我的系统里面已经有了这个补丁。O(∩_∩)O~